|
|
Publicēts 09.07.2015 23:53:27
|
|
|

- <Directory /www/web/test>
- Options FollowSymLinks
- AllowOverride All
- Order allow,deny
- Allow from all
- </Directory>
Kopēt kodu Kad mēs apmeklējam vietni, beigās pievienojiet atbilstošo direktoriju, un mēs varam pārlūkot direktoriju, kas vietnei ir ļoti nedroša.
Risinājums: 1. Rediģējiet httpd.conf failu vi ./conffile:///C:\Users\lenovo\AppData\Local\Temp\@IR3P(8S$C$Z$TY~5I{QEPC.giftpd.conf
Atrodiet tālāk norādīto. ...... <Direktorijs "C:/Program Files/Apache2.2file:///C:\Users\lenovo\AppData\Local\Temp\@IR3P(8S$C$Z$TY~5I{QEPC.gifdocs"> # # Iespējamās opcijas direktīvas vērtības ir "Nav", "Visi", # vai jebkura kombinācija: Indeksi ietver FollowSymLinks SymLinksifOwnerMatch ExecCGI MultiViews # # Ņemiet vērā, ka "MultiViews" ir jānosauc * skaidri * --- "Opcijas visi" # jums to nedod. # # Opciju direktīva ir gan sarežģīta, gan svarīga. Lūdzu, skatiet # http://httpd.apache.org/docs/2.2/mod/core.html#options # lai iegūtu vairāk informācijas. # Opcijas Indeksi FollowSymLinks
# # AllowOverride kontrolē, kādas direktīvas var ievietot .htaccess failos. # Tas var būt "Visi", "Nav" vai jebkura atslēgvārdu kombinācija: # Opcijas FileInfo AuthConfig Limit # AllowOverride Nav
# # Kontrolē, kas var iegūt lietas no šī servera. # Pasūtīt atļaut,noraidīt Atļaut no visiem
</Directory> ......
Sadaļā Opcijas Indeksi FollowSymLinks indeksiem ievadiet simbolu -. Proti: opcijas -indeksi FollowSymLinks [Piezīme: Pirms indeksiem pievienot + nozīmē, ka satura rādītāju ir atļauts pārlūkot; Plus - Pārstāv aizliegtu kataloga pārlūkošanu. 】
Šajā gadījumā viss Apache aizliedza direktoriju pārlūkošanu.
Virtuālā hostinga gadījumā vienkārši pievienojiet šādu informāciju: <Direktorijs "D:\test"> Opcijas -Indeksi FollowSymLinks AllowOverride Nav Pasūtījuma noraidīšana,atļaut Atļaut no visiem </Directory> Šajā gadījumā ir aizliegts pārlūkot direktoriju testa projektā.
Piezīme: Atcerieties nemainīt "Atļaut no visiem" uz "Noraidīt no visiem", pretējā gadījumā visa vietne netiks atvērta.
http://morgan363.javaeye.com/blog/645363
Kā Apache bloķē direktoriju sarakstu, saglabājot noklusējuma lapu piekļuvei direktorijam? Atslēgvārdi: php Atrodiet direktorija atribūtu, kas jāiestata Apache konfigurācijas failā httpd.conf, un noņemiet indeksus rindā Opcijas Piemēram: <Direktorijs "d:\web"> Opcijas Indeksi FollowSymLinks </Directory> Mainīts uz: <Direktorijs "d:\web"> Opcijas FollowSymLinks </Directory>
----------------------------------------------------------------- Aizstājvārds /edit/ "/home[img]file:///C:\Users\lenovo\AppData\Local\Temp\~(H)[A[}_FC3OBSP~]S'RV8.gif[/img]php[img]file:///C:\Users\lenovo\AppData\Local\Temp\~(H)[A[}_FC3OBSP~ ]S'RV8.gif[/img]/"
<Direktorijs "/home[img]file:///C:\Users\lenovo\AppData\Local\Temp\~(H)[A[}_FC3OBSP~]S'RV8.gif[/img]php[img]file:///C:\Users\lenovo\AppData\Local\Temp\~(H)[A[}_FC3OBSP~] S'RV8.gif[/img]"> Opcijas Indeksi MultiViews => Opcijas MultiViews AllowOverride Nav Pasūtīt atļaut,noraidīt Atļaut no visiem </Directory>
Kad esat noņēmis indeksus, saraksti nebūs atļauti.
|
Iepriekšējo:Definējiet PHP-FPM php.ini parametrus Nginx CONFNākamo:Linux, lai skatītu lietotāja darbības procesa komandas
|